Apple's satellite SOS service allows iPhone 14 and newer models to send emergency text messages via satellite when cellular and Wi-Fi networks are unavailable. The service connects users directly to emergency services—and now, to AAA Roadside Assistance—through a simple, guided process. Apple states the satellite connection typically takes less than 15 seconds under clear skies, making it a fast and reliable emergency communication tool.
Even without cellular service (when your phone’s signal icon displays "SOS"), iPhone 14+ users can still contact 911 and access AAA Roadside Assistance through satellite. Here's how:
Dial or text 911 to connect with emergency services, even if you have no cellular signal.
Start a text conversation with emergency services if calling isn’t possible.
Connect with AAA through satellite by answering a short questionnaire about your situation and location.
Get updates from a AAA agent who will arrange roadside assistance.
On-screen prompts will guide you through each step, making satellite messaging easy, even if it’s your first time using it.
You can also type "roadside assistance," "help," "send help," "emergency," "emergencies," "service," or "flat tire." To make sure that you can access Roadside Assistance via satellite with these key words, update your iPhone to the latest software before going off the grid.

Learn MoreAll users of iPhone 14 or later of any model (with iOS17 installed) in the United States can access AAA Roadside Assistance via satellite. The service is available to both AAA Members and non-members:
AAA Members: Your membership is verified, and assistance is provided according to your plan benefits at no extra charge.
Non-members: Payment is required after service is completed, with rates depending on the assistance needed.
This ensures anyone with a compatible iPhone can get help, regardless of membership status.

The service is designed for remote locations where cell service is unavailable, such as:
Rural highways
National parks and mountain ranges
Beaches and coastal areas without cell towers
Off-grid campsites
For the best connection, you'll need a clear view of the sky. Obstructions like dense trees or mountains can interfere with the satellite signal, so you may need to move to an open area.

No. Apple's satellite SOS service is specifically designed for areas with no cellular coverage or Wi-Fi. The iPhone connects directly to satellites to send and receive messages with emergency services and AAA.
No. The satellite SOS feature with AAA Roadside Assistance is only available on iPhone 14, 15, 16, 17, and newer models. Older iPhone models do not have the necessary satellite hardware.
Non-members will be charged upon service completion. Rates vary based on the type and location of service needed. A AAA Membership typically offers better value for those who may need multiple roadside assistance calls per year.
Apple's Emergency SOS via satellite is available in select countries. As of 2026, AAA Roadside Assistance via satellite is available only in the United States. Check Apple's website for the most current list of supported countries for emergency satellite messaging.
AAA can assist with flat tires, dead batteries, lockouts, fuel delivery, towing and other common roadside emergencies. The AAA agent will assess your situation through satellite text messaging and dispatch the appropriate service.
